MONTANA HEALTH FEDERAL CREDIT UNION COLLECTS NONPUBLIC PERSONAL INFORMATION ABOUT YOU FROM THE FOLLOWING SOURCES:
1. Information we receive from you on applications or other forms
2. Information about your transactions with us and our affiliates.
3. Information we receive from a consumer-reporting agency
4. Information obtained when verifying the information you provide on an application or other forms, such as from your current or past employers or from other institutions where you conduct financial transactions.

HOW WE PROTECT YOUR INFORMATION
We restrict access to nonpublic personal information about you to those employees who have a specific business purpose in utilizing your data. Our employees are trained in the importance of maintaining confidentiality and member privacy. We maintain physical, electronic, and procedural safeguards that comply with federal regulations and leading industry practices to safeguard your nonpublic personal information.
INFORMATION WE MAY DISCLOSE ABOUT YOU
We are committed to providing you with competitive products and services to meet your financial needs which may require that we share information about you with others to complete your transactions and provide you with a choice of products and services. In doing so, we may disclose all of the information we collect, as described above. Accordingly, we may disclose the following kinds of nonpublic personal information about you:
1. Information we receive from you on applications and other forms, such as your name, address, social security number, and income.
2. Information about your transactions with us or other companies that work closely with us to provide you with financial products and services, such as your account balances, payment history, and credit card usage.
3. Information we receive from a consumer reporting agency, such as your creditworthiness and credit history.
We may also disclose all the information we collect, as described above, to companies that perform marketing or other services on our behalf or to other financial institutions with whom we have joint marketing agreements. To protect our members' privacy, we only work with companies that agree to maintain strong confidentiality protections and limit the use of information we provide. We do not allow these companies to sell the member information we provide to other third parties.
Lastly, in order to conduct the business of the credit union, we may disclose nonpublic personal information about you as permitted or required by law. These disclosures typically include information to process transactions on your behalf, conduct the operations of our credit union, follow your instructions as you authorize, or protect the security of our financial records.
